The earliest slot machines had only one payline and could only display a limited number of symbols. However, the development of electronic components allowed manufacturers to weight specific symbols more frequently than others. This reduced the maximum possible jackpot size and lowered the odds of winning on the payline.

Modern video slots can have up to 20 or more paylines. They can also include features such as Sticky Wilds, which will trigger multipliers or free spins when they appear on the reels. Some slots feature Progressive Jackpots, which grow every time a player plays them.
